26 Math insets do not know there parents, a cursor position or things
27 like that. The are dumb object that are contained in other math insets
28 (MathNestInsets, in fact) thus forming a tree. The root of this tree is
29 always a MathHullInset, which provides an interface to the Outer World by
30 inclusion in the "real LyX insets" FormulaInset and FormulaMacroInset.
